Penn Jillette was born on March 5, 1955, in Greenfield, Massachusetts. He is not just a magician. He wears many hats. He is also a comedian, musician, actor, and best-selling author (1).

1. Emmy Awards
Penn Jillette has received several nominations for the Primetime Emmy Awards. Here are some of the years he was recognized:
- 2006: Nominated for Outstanding Reality Program for “Prostitution.”
- 2007: Nominated for Outstanding Writing for Nonfiction Programming for “Wal-Mart.”
- 2009: Nominated for Outstanding Writing for Nonfiction Programming for “New Age Medicine.” (3)

2. BAFTA Awards
In 2014, Jillette was nominated for a BAFTA Film Award. He earned this nomination for Best Documentary for Tim’s Vermeer, which he worked on with Teller and Farley Ziegler. The BAFTA Awards are known for honoring the best in film and television, so this nomination is a big deal!
3. Walk of Fame
In 2013, Penn received a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ame. This honor was for his contributions to the entertainment industry, and he shared this moment with Teller. It must have been a proud day for him to see his name among so many famous stars!
